// Swapping out our crusty homegrown job queue for Drayloom's hosted
// broker. The old cron-plus-table hack couldn't handle retries without
// double-firing, and nobody wants to debug that again. This client
// connects to the Drayloom staging cluster; prod config lands next
// sprint. It authenticates with the service key below.

service key, yadug-bajog: zpat3_pou

Hi all,

Quick heads-up for branch managers: we've signed the franchise agreement with Copperleaf Provisions to operate Brindlehop Coffee counters in our Westmoor and Tallowfield branches. Their fit-out crews start next month, so expect a bit of noise and some rearranged floor space. Staffing stays with Copperleaf; our only job is footfall reporting and keeping the shared areas tidy. Rollout to other branches depends on how the first two perform. The confidential business-plan summary behind this decision is attached just below.

board note of kageg-bahof: The renewal with Holwynax Holdings closes at $2 million a year, 5 percent below the last contract. Project Ulaath slips by two quarters because of the supplier delay.

Fan-out backpressure for the Quillet notifier: when the queue depth crosses the soft limit, the dispatcher sheds low-priority pushes and batches the rest at 500ms intervals. Reviewer should confirm the shed counter is exported and that retries respect the jitter window. Once merged, the release artifact gets re-signed by the pipeline, which expects the deploy key shown below.

deploy key for bawep-yawif: bky6_GQhaSt